You might notice that there was no release email for the 3.0.0 release, so let us shed some light on that release. What changed? ovirt-node-3.0.0 was a major release which brought some major changes. One important change is, that Node is now an "universal image" [2]. The base Node images (for Fedora 19 and EL6) do _not_ contain any specific VDSM bits anymore and can _not_ be used directly with oVirt Engine. The VDSM specific parts got extracted and can be found in the ovirt-node-plugin-vdsm [3][4]. For convenience we plan to provide additional images containing the VDSM plugin which will make the images ready to use with oVirt Engine. For this release we need to delay the release of the VDSM images due to some last-minute bugs. There are also many more new features in 3.0 [0][5]: * Universal Image - Remove VDSM specific bits to make the image more general (an VDSM image is still provided) * Improved upgrade tool * Software iSCSI root * Puppet configuration management (plugin) * Bridegeless Networking * NIC Bonds * New installer TUI * IPv6 support in the setup TUI * Diagnostics page in the setup TUI * Images for Fedora 19 and EL6 Let us know [6][7] if you found an issue, miss something which should be part of Node or would like to use Node in your project.
